Rick Fabiani brings over ten years of experience practicing law in helping his clients. His first focus is always on understanding the client’s goals and helping find the most effective way to reach those goals, whether representing individuals or corporate clients. Rick helps clients with real estate and business transactions, including closing and title services, and litigation in a wide range of civil matters. He has developed a reputation of being able to solve problems in difficult situations. From creative professionals to musicians to programmers to engineers and others, Rick has helped negotiate and litigate contracts for hundreds of contractors, professionals, and companies. Rick has an ability to understand the unique needs of clients in constantly changing and emerging fields.
Rick grew up in Gainesville, but graduated high school from Douglas Anderson School of the Arts, in Jacksonville, where he was first chair Double Bass in the orchestra. He graduated from the Honors program at Santa Fe College and earned his B.A. from the University of Florida with a double major in anthropology and philosophy. He graduated from the Tulane University School of Law in 2008 where he was on the Board for the Tulane Environmental Law Journal, as well as being elected to represent the law school in student government and serving on the honor board. He also practiced as a student attorney at the Tulane Environmental Law Clinic.
Rick is admitted was admitted to the Florida Bar in 2008 and is currently admitted to federal practice in the Northern and Middle Districts of Florida. He is a past member of the Eighth Judicial Bar Association Board.
Rick is still a musician and is also a competitive fencer. He also was a recent co-producer of the Tom Petty Birthday Bash music festival in Gainesville, celebrating the life and music of Tom Petty.
